April 28th, 2009 by Greg

After 30 years I am yet again trying to give up smoking.

I started smoking at a mere 10 years old, and have on numerous occassions tried giving up but generally lasted no more than about 5 hours. This time is different, I hope, I went to bed Sunday night ensuring I smoked the last fag, that’s a cigarette and not what you might think, so yesturday morning I awoke with no smokes around to grab.

Boy it was hard work yesturday, me and Tracey bickerring all the time, the kids getting snapped at for the silliest thing and the food cupboard being raided all the time.

People say, keep busy to take mind off it, but when ‘busy’ is sat working at computer where you’ve always sat with a cig in your hand, it doesn’t help much.

We got thru the first day, it’s now 10am on Tuesday and I haven’t had a smoke for about 36 hours, I am not sure I can do this, the temptation to shoot out and buy some is so great.

April 23rd, 2009 by Greg

OK, I announced my intention for an EC clone, well I am about to start work on it again. My other project is not completed but I feel that this has the momentum and is worth prioritising.

I have looked at the code I started some while ago and much of it may need redoing, I only started php a few months ago and have learned some better technics since the first time I looked at this.

I do think I should let people know about me a bit, as I do not have an about me page and people may think I am doing this just to upset Graham, but that is definately not the case.

I am disabled so working on computers was really my only option and had a few minor data entry jobs when I left school, I had some knowlege of programming in ‘basic’ but that was it. In 1997 I became an affiliate of a Web hosting company, and about 3 months later they made me their first remote Senior reseller, not based on sales but based on the help I gave other resellers on the forums. This role soon turned into a paid position, and within about 4 months I was Support Administrator and had about 8 others working for me doing customer and affiliate support.

During that time I learned to program in Perl, one of the company owners recommended some  books and helped me out now and again. I left the company around 2000 as it had been sold to a big national telecoms co and I wasn’t enjoying the work or the direction the company was heading. Since then I have mostly worked for myself, with the odd period of employment in between.

I now code for a living, but the thing that sticks with me from the Hosting days is Customer Service/Support should always be a priority.  Unhappy users/clients eventually leads to no users/clients. If you have problems with the service you’re providing then as long as the users  are   kept in the loop etc  most will stick by you.

This is why I have made this decision, I do not believe we as EC users have seen the Customer Service/Support nor been considered when decisions have been made and there appear to by high numbers of ‘unhappy’ users around because of it.

April 6th, 2009 by Greg

I’ve been browsing around and reading some blogs for views about the new Entrecard paid ads and one thing that came to me was the fact it is so much ‘cheaper’ it is to pay for advertising rather than using your Entrecard credits.

I tooked at my recent top ads, the ads I’ve placed which have had the most clicks, now using the value Entrecard give to their credits of 1000 credits = $6, on average each click is costing me about 10 cents per click, if I paid for those clicks with hard cash, I could get advertising for just 2 cents per click, thats just a  fifth of the cost.

This could well explain why then I am getting pages of ‘paid’ ad requests waiting approval but absolutely no ‘normal’ ads requests meaning I will not earn anything from showing ads if I approved them all and any existing ‘normal’ ads would get less advertising for their credits. This then makes me ask, what is the point of dropping now?  why would you drop for at least two days (2×300 drops) to earn enough credits to advertise on a fairly popular blog when you can just pay peanuts and get your ad pushed to the front of the que?

I understand Entrecard need money but they have not spent enough time thinking about the best way to generate income, this is one reason I have not yet launched my own ‘dropping’ site.

I will stress now, I am not currently approving paid ads, to ensure my ‘normal’ advertisers get the advertising they expect.
